Watchung Hills SA/Match Fit Academy Announce Partnership for NJ Elite Program

As many of you may have seen, WHSA announced a new training partnership and program this morning (see press release below).  We realize you may have some questions, so wanted to share some additional information with you:
 
1) The goal of this program is to keep players in our club rather than have them look for opportunities elsewhere.  Players participating in the NJ Elite Program will have a heavier commitment level through additional training sessions and tournament play.
2) Match Fit and United Soccer Academy will train these teams.  We will hold mandatory parent meetings with current teams that will qualify for this program and we will reach out to those teams in a separate email. 
3) We expect to add additional teams in future seasons.   However, we will not offer the NJ Elite Program at the U9 and U10 age groups as we do not believe players have reached a point in their development where they should entertain a heavier commitment level.
4) Tryouts for NJ Elite teams and WHSA travel teams will occur at the same time.  The tryout schedule and pricing for NJ Elite teams will be released soon.

PRESS RELEASE

(March 14, 2019) - Watchung Hills Soccer Association (WHSA) and Match Fit Academy FC (MFAFC) are pleased to announce their Strategic Training Partnership.  In conjunction with this new partnership, WHSA is also proud to announce the expansion of its NJ Elite Program to include NJ Elite teams at certain age groups. MFAFC trainers will coach and train many of those teams.
 
WHSA has had a strong track record of developing highly competitive youth boys' and girls' soccer teams. The WHSA NJ Elite teams will continue to build upon WHSA's successful NJ Elite and Travel Programs and provide all players a potential pathway to ECNL and NPL through the partnership with MFAFC.
 
NJ Elite will build upon the success of the current NJ Elite and WHSA Travel programs by bridging the competitive gap between those two programs.  NJ Elite teams will initially compete in EDP mid to upper level flights and provide another level of play for the committed soccer player. 
 
NJ Elite teams will be reserved for players seeking a higher, more committed level of competition and will have the following key features:
 
  • Full time Professional staff coach/trainer
  • Oversight by MFAFC and WHSA Directors of Coaching
  • Access to ECNL and NPL Boys and Girls programs through MFAFC
  • Player pathway through collaboration
  • All training and match play will continue out of WHSA's turf facilities
